On May 1st, 2019, Japan changed eras from the Heisei to the Reiwa when Emperor Naruhito ascended the throne. This is a historic moment of celebration and now you can commemorate the unique occasion with the New Japanese Era Reiwa Toilet Paper, a special limited edition household item. The meaning of Reiwa is "beautiful harmony."
